Best Merrell hiking shoes-The Merrell brand in a nutshell

Merrell’s motto revolves around 4 words: Comfort, Design, Durability and Versatility.
Merrell has developed by creating quality hiking models but has been able to diversify by designing fast hiking, Nordic walking and trail running models.
The brand’s mission was to combine the technique of cowboy boots with the manufacture of Italian boots. Merrell footwear brings cutting-edge performance and technology.

Merrel Moab FST GTX 2

Moab FST GTX 2 – Merrell
- Lug depth: 5 mm.
Presentation of the model
The pair of Merrell Men’s Moab GTX walking shoes are versatile and comfortable, they are suitable for all types of activity. Equipped with a cushioning insole and a gripping sole for maximum comfort.
Why this pair of shoes?
Gore Tex technology gives this model impermeability and breathability. Foam tongue helps repel debris and moisture. The tip has a rubber protection.
Model Features

- Leather top
- Lining: Synthetic
- Insole: Synthetic
- Outsole: Synthetic
- Closing system: Laces
This pair of waterproof hiking shoes offers the protection and insulation needed for excellent comfort on any type of surface.
Merrell Capra Gore-Tex

Capra Gore-Tex – Merrell
- Suede leather and abrasion resistant mesh upper
Presentation of the model

The pair of Merrell Capra hiking shoes are resistant and protective. It exists in several low/high versions.
The high pair of shoes is particularly suitable for rough terrain and in hybrid environments with its technology and high upper.
The Capra’s suede leather finish gives it warmth, durability and good looks.
Why this pair of shoes?
This pair provides excellent grip and good comfort. There is no friction and the foot is airy. It is designed for mountain hiking suitable for all climates and on technical trails. It is intended for both novices and experts.
Model Features

- Leather top
- Lining: Mesh
- Insole: Synthetic
- Outsole: Synthetic
- Closing system: Laces
- Waterproofing: Yes
- Variations: low/high
The pair of Merrell Capra Gore Tex shoes are light, resistant and protective. They are perfect for evolving in the snow or on the ice. With its grip it is possible to do a little climbing. The ankle is perfectly maintained and it is a solid shoe.
Ridgepass Thermo Mid

Ridgepass Thermo Mid – Merrell
Presentation of the model
The pair of Ridgepass Thermo mid-rise shoes is ideal for winter with its fleece lining the feet are well kept warm. The sole is solid and the cleats are grippy, the ankle is well maintained and the foot does not move at all.
Why this pair of shoes?

These lightweight Merrell hiking shoes with excellent comfort offer excellent performance.
The materials are of very good quality and the shoe lasts over time.
It has good abrasion resistance after use on all types of terrain. Be sure to take a size above for this model.
Technical characteristics

- Leather top
- Lining: Textile
- Insole: Synthetic
- Outsole: Rubber
- Closing system: Laces
- Waterproofing: yes
- Variations: Male/female
- Use: all terrain
We recommend a use rather in winter because this model keeps warm. This pair of Merrell shoes is very comfortable and has a very nice finish (winter). It is excellent value for money.
